Taylor, Adam (2016) Is it ever a good idea to perform self-surgery. The Conversation.
Full text not available from this repository.Abstract
The human body has a capacity to repair almost all of its tissues and does so on a daily basis in response to things such as exercise. Bone in particular is good at healing itself. But when things go catastrophically wrong, beyond the capacity of the body to repair itself, it requires intervention from an external source – usually a surgeon.
